Journalism Career Journey
The journalism career of Sarah McMullan began away from national television, where she gained essential experience in reporting, research, and storytelling. These early roles demanded versatility, accuracy, and resilience, helping her develop the newsroom discipline required for broadcast journalism at a higher level.
Her time at STV News marked an important stepping stone. Covering a wide range of stories, Sarah McMullan refined her on-screen presence and editorial judgement. This period allowed her to build professional confidence and visibility, ultimately paving the way for her transition to the BBC.
BBC Scotland Career and Reporting Scotland Role
Joining BBC Scotland was a defining moment for Sarah McMullan, placing her at the centre of Scottish broadcast journalism. As a presenter on Reporting Scotland, she delivers breakfast and lunchtime bulletins that cover politics, health, education, and breaking news affecting communities across the country.
In this role, Sarah McMullan demonstrates balance and authority, managing live broadcasts and sensitive topics with composure. Her work has helped reinforce Reporting Scotland’s reputation as a trusted news programme, while also establishing her as a reliable and respected BBC journalist.

Who is Sarah McMullan?
Sarah McMullan is a Scottish journalist and BBC Scotland presenter best known for her work on Reporting Scotland, where she delivers breakfast and lunchtime news to audiences across the country.
How old is Sarah McMullan?
Sarah McMullan was born in 1992, making her part of a younger generation of British broadcast journalists who have quickly risen through the industry.
